Narcan Training

forestpark

The Cook County Medical Examiner’s Office stated that there were 1,822 opioid-related deaths in 2023. In this program, the University of IL Extension presents the statistics surrounding opioid use, emerging trends, how to respond to an opioid overdose, and how to use life-saving nasal naloxone as well as how to use fentanyl test strips. Summer Concert Series: Kaben Kafo

riverforestlibrary

Get your lawn chairs ready for the return of our annual outdoor concert series! This month, we'll enjoy a performance of traditional West African djembe drumming courtesy of Kaben Kafo, a percussion ensemble whose name means "let's play together" in the Malinke language. This style of drum music dates back to the 12th century. Limited seating will be provided, but you are welcome to bring your own lawn chairs. In the event of rain, the concert will be moved indoors to the Library's second floor.
